The Architecture of a Modular Vape System

Green RAZ VUE 50K modular disposable vape displaying the smart screen with battery life and 12W Normal Mode active, surrounded by vapor.

Traditional high-capacity disposables require users to discard an entire battery, screen, and circuit board once the e-liquid runs out. The RAZ VUE 50K changes this dynamic through a two-piece modular setup.

  • Smart Docking Station: A reusable 900mAh power bank equipped with a full-color digital screen. This component remains with the user and handles the main power supply, active power adjustments, and system animations.
  • Detachable Flavor Pods: Pre-filled 13mL pods containing 5% salt nicotine e-liquid. Each pod houses an integrated 420mAh battery and a dual mesh coil structure.

When docked, the combined power totals 1320mAh, ensuring stable power delivery. When a pod is empty, you only replace the detachable pod itself, keeping the smart base station intact. This design sharply minimizes electronic waste while maintaining the convenience of a traditional disposable device.

Performance and Power Modes

The hardware configuration allows users to toggle between two distinct operational modes via an adjustable bottom airflow mechanism. Performance metrics scale according to the chosen wattage:

Vaping Mode Wattage Maximum Puff Count Vapor Volume
Normal Mode 12W Up to 50,000 Puffs Standard
Boost Mode 24W Up to 25,000 Puffs Enhanced

The full-color interface tracks real-time battery levels and active power modes. The dual mesh coil structure preserves flavor consistency across both settings, preventing the burnt taste often associated with older high-capacity devices as the e-liquid levels drop.
